Otto Addo must believe in himself and make firm decisions – Kwesi Nyantakyi

Former Ghana Football Association (GFA) president Kwesi Nyantakyi has provided the roadmap to making Otto Addo successful with the Black Stars.

Ghana is returning to the global showpiece after missing out in Russia 2018.

The West African powerhouse are paired in Group H against Portugal, Uruguay and South Korea.

Speaking to KINGS TVGH SPORTS, the former 1st CAF Vice President advised Otto Addo to believe in himself and make firm decisions ahead of the 2022 World Cup in Qatar.

“Everyone in Ghana loves football, so there are many different perspectives. We usually say that we’re all coaches,”

“Otto Addo must believe in himself and understand that he is there because he deserves the position.”

“He should select the best Ghanaian players to represent the country at the World Cup.”

“He’ll be confused if he listens to what everyone says, because I have an opinion, and you [interviewee] have an opinion, but we’re not coaches.”

“He should be firm and not tolerate opinions that won’t benefit him,” he added.

Nyantakyi led the Ghana FA between 2005 to 2018.
